Output d0b51808987513d14abe775e6f2e34a19b52f815c19abf74b67ec760d8105a31:0

value
105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8786ef7a42b04c8726d50aae72331afceb697c OP_EQUAL
address
39wh6Pv4yWQhWemxNWcJGaK2mcwvrtQ8Zs
transaction
d0b51808987513d14abe775e6f2e34a19b52f815c19abf74b67ec760d8105a31
spent
true